Output 83e4394317eb6fe933ca4995e73264d19bb43ca5f9e43d1c82a8ca87969b8f3b:38

value
1698657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e35bd2d7fc3dfab98add6327b7df76acb70b29 OP_EQUAL
address
34sVGDyF3CGKw8g3QWuLx1QT62BUvYz75r
transaction
83e4394317eb6fe933ca4995e73264d19bb43ca5f9e43d1c82a8ca87969b8f3b
spent
true